KKMWDN
KKMWDN
  • 发布:2023-08-25 15:39
  • 更新:2023-08-25 15:39
  • 阅读:165

在uniapp中的nvue页面下使用WebView中的视频在ios全屏的时候被ios原生视频接管啦【报Bug】在ios

分类:uni-app

产品分类: uniapp/App

PC开发环境操作系统: Mac

PC开发环境操作系统版本号: ios

HBuilderX类型: 正式

HBuilderX版本号: 3.8.12

手机系统: iOS

手机系统版本号: iOS 16

手机厂商: 苹果

手机机型: 所有ios

页面类型: nvue

vue版本: vue2

打包方式: 云端

项目创建方式: HBuilderX

示例代码:

<template>
<view class="content">
<web-view ref="muiPlayer" class="muiPlayer" :src="src"></web-view>
</view>
</template>

<script>
export default {
name: "muiPlayer",
data() {
return {
src: "../../hybrid/html/local.html",
};
},
onReady() {
plus.webview.currentWebview().addEventListener('fullscreenchange', function(e) {
if (e.fullscreen) {
console.log('全屏');
} else {
console.log('退出全屏');
}
});
},
methods: {}
}
</script>

<style>
.muiPlayer {
width: 750rpx;
height: 210px;
}
</style>

操作步骤:

直接就是这样

预期结果:

在ios全屏的时候横屏显示

实际结果:

在ios全屏的时候被ios原生视频接管啦

bug描述:

在uniapp中的nvue页面下使用WebView中的视频在ios全屏的时候被ios原生视频接管啦

2023-08-25 15:39 负责人:无 分享
已邀请:

要回复问题请先登录注册